Monitoring, backups and recovery deserve written answers

Bosseo states that Dedicated Hosting includes 24/7 monitoring and automatic daily backups. Its public page also describes managed security updates and a migration process that can include files, databases, DNS and SSL. These capabilities address different risks: monitoring concerns detection, backups concern recovery, and migration concerns continuity during a change of host. None of them removes the need to define responsibilities and test the result.

Recommended approach

Ask what is monitored, how an incident is identified, who responds, how long backups are retained, how a restoration is requested and how restoration is tested. Confirm which parts of the website and its data are included. For a firm serving Casas Adobes, document the pages, contact paths and forms that must be checked after any incident or recovery.

Security and permissions for a law firm website

Bosseo’s page identifies SSL, firewall and DDoS protection, security updates and hardening as part of its hosting description. Hosting security is only one part of a firm’s broader risk management. Permissions also matter: website administrators, domain control, DNS access, form destinations and third-party accounts should have clearly assigned owners. The available information does not establish your firm’s compliance obligations or the configuration of every outside service.

Recommended approach

Create an access inventory before the consultation. Record who controls the domain, hosting account, DNS, website administration, forms and email records. Ask Bosseo which permissions it needs, which remain with the firm, how changes are authorized and how access is removed. Keep the decision focused on documented responsibilities rather than an unqualified security conclusion.

Migration planning for your Casas Adobes site

Bosseo states that it handles migration end to end and describes staging, testing, DNS switching, SSL and email-record handling. The public page also says Bosseo can host websites it did not build. Whether a particular migration is suitable depends on the current platform, database, DNS configuration, email setup, redirects and other site-specific details.

Recommended approach

Request a migration review that identifies the current host, domain registrar, DNS provider, website platform, databases, redirects, SSL certificates, forms and email records. Define a cutover plan and a rollback decision before approval. After the change, check representative Casas Adobes pages, contact paths, redirects, indexing controls and email flow rather than assuming a successful DNS change proves the whole site works.
